Strahil Peak (Bulgarian: връх Страхил, romanizedvrah Strahil, IPA: [ˈvrɤx strɐˈxiɫ]) is the sharp rocky peak rising to 2700 m just west of the main crest of north-central Sentinel Range in Ellsworth Mountains, Antarctica. It is named after the Bulgarian rebel leader Strahil Voyvoda (mid-17th century – c. 1711).

Location[edit]

Strahil Peak is located at 78°05′40″S 86°20′01.5″W / 78.09444°S 86.333750°W / -78.09444; -86.333750, which is 2.8 km northwest of Mount Hale, 8.2 km east-northeast of Mount Hubley, 8.63 km southeast of Silyanov Peak and 7.7 km south of Brocks Peak. US mapping in 1961 and 1988.
